16-year-old TikTok sensation Siya Kakkar dies by suicide

ST Staff

Siya Kakkar, a 16-year-old TikTok sensation and dancer, died by suicide on June 25 in New Delhi, taking a toll on the world of online entertainment. The news comes after the death of Crime Patrol actress Preksha Mehta and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put. Sushant, too, committed suicide by hanging on June 14. The 34-year-old actor’s death took the whole nation and the entire Bollywood fraternity aback. He was found dead in his Mumbai apartment and was allegedly suffering from depression for the past six months.

Kakkar, a TikTok sensation, lived in Preet Vihar in New Delhi. Arjun Sarin, who managed all of Kakkar’s work and endorsements, confirmed her death. He said, “This must be due to something personal...work-wise she was doing well. I had a word with her last night for a new project, and she sounded normal. Me and my company Fame Experts manage lots of artists and Siya was a bright talent. I am heading to her home in Preet Vihar.”

Kakkar used multiple social media platforms like TikTok, Instagram, YouTube and Snapchat and earned fame amongst the youth through her videos showcasing her dancing skills. She has a huge follower base on all her social media handles. She had over 1.1 million followers on TikTok and 104k followers on Instagram.
